CVE-2026-19919: code-projects Online Shopping System Login login.php sql injection
A vulnerability was found in code-projects Online Shopping System 1.0. This impacts an unknown function of the file /login.php of the component Login. The manipulation of the argument email results in sql injection. The attack may be performed from remote. The exploit has been made public and could be used.
